The Best School for Your Child offers parents a guide to identifying the secondary school that will best meet the unique needs, qualities and strengths of their son or daughter. The author is an Australian teacher and high school counsellor.
Selecting the 'right' high school is crucial as it will be the world in which a teenager learns to develop socially, emotionally and morally. The right environment can help children enjoy learning, discover their talents and, possibly, their future career path.
This book offers real-life stories from parents, children and teachers as to how they assessed qualities in different schools – and what mattered to them. The Best School For Your Child demonstrates that to really understand what a school is like, parents need to consider its culture, curricula, reputation, climate, programs and policies.

happychild's Review
The best way to describe this book, in our opinion, is that it truly gets to the essence of what matters in choosing a high school for your child. Erin Shale wisely and empathetically guides parents through the many indicators of whether a school is the best choice for your child. Looking at kids as individuals and looking beyond academic results and community gossip, Erin advises parents on working with their child to examine important factors including school climate and culture, curriculum and extra-curricular activities, location and public versus private options. We especially like the emphasis on the important point that the right high school is "worth its weight in gold" and can make an enormous difference to teenagers' happiness and success.
Highlights/Quotes
"You do not have to begin the search for your child's secondary school the day you discover you are going to become a parent. Look beyond the words in glossy publications and websites and examine the heart of the messages. Does what you find reflect values you want your child to have? Is there evidence of the level of care your child deserves?" "Capable and caring teachers can make or break the experience your child has at school. Gather as much information as possible about the teachers at various schools and the level of staff satisfaction and happiness."
